Kenya's Emerging Tech Talent Pool: A Global Advantage

Kenya's technology sector is booming, driven by a young, dynamic population eager to engage with global innovation. Nairobi, often dubbed 'Silicon Savannah', is a hub for startups and established tech firms, fostering a culture of innovation and skill development. Universities and vocational institutions across Kenya are producing graduates proficient in software development, data science, cybersecurity, and AI. This influx of talent is not only catering to local demand but is increasingly looking towards international opportunities. Canadian companies can tap into this pool, finding skilled professionals who are adaptable, eager to learn, and ready to contribute to cutting-edge projects. The country's commitment to digital transformation further solidifies its position as a reliable source of tech expertise.

Cost-Effectiveness and Project Viability in Kenya

When considering international hiring, cost is a significant factor. While specific salary expectations vary based on skill and experience, the overall cost of employing tech talent in Kenya is generally more competitive than in North America. For instance, a mid-level software developer might command a salary in the range of KES 150,000 - KES 300,000 per month, significantly lower than comparable roles in Canada. This allows Canadian companies to optimize their budget without compromising on talent quality.
